北京中醫(yī)藥大學《數(shù)據(jù)管理與數(shù)據(jù)庫》2023-2024學年第二學期期末試卷_第1頁
北京中醫(yī)藥大學《數(shù)據(jù)管理與數(shù)據(jù)庫》2023-2024學年第二學期期末試卷_第2頁
北京中醫(yī)藥大學《數(shù)據(jù)管理與數(shù)據(jù)庫》2023-2024學年第二學期期末試卷_第3頁
北京中醫(yī)藥大學《數(shù)據(jù)管理與數(shù)據(jù)庫》2023-2024學年第二學期期末試卷_第4頁
北京中醫(yī)藥大學《數(shù)據(jù)管理與數(shù)據(jù)庫》2023-2024學年第二學期期末試卷_第5頁
全文預(yù)覽已結(jié)束

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)

文檔簡介

學校________________班級____________姓名____________考場____________準考證號學校________________班級____________姓名____________考場____________準考證號…………密…………封…………線…………內(nèi)…………不…………要…………答…………題…………第1頁,共3頁北京中醫(yī)藥大學《數(shù)據(jù)管理與數(shù)據(jù)庫》

2023-2024學年第二學期期末試卷題號一二三四總分得分批閱人一、單選題(本大題共25個小題,每小題1分,共25分.在每小題給出的四個選項中,只有一項是符合題目要求的.)1、選擇排序是另一種基本的排序算法。以下關(guān)于選擇排序的說法,錯誤的是:()A.選擇排序每次從待排序序列中選擇最小(或最大)的元素,放到已排序序列的末尾B.選擇排序在最壞情況下的時間復(fù)雜度為O(n^2)C.選擇排序是一種不穩(wěn)定的排序算法D.選擇排序的空間復(fù)雜度較低2、哈夫曼樹是一種最優(yōu)二叉樹,常用于數(shù)據(jù)壓縮。以下關(guān)于哈夫曼樹的特點,錯誤的是()A.帶權(quán)路徑長度最小B.沒有度為1的節(jié)點C.權(quán)值越大的節(jié)點離根節(jié)點越近D.哈夫曼樹的構(gòu)建過程是唯一的3、設(shè)計一個基于Zynq的異構(gòu)計算平臺,實現(xiàn)圖像處理和數(shù)據(jù)加密等功能,給出硬件架構(gòu)和軟件編程模型。4、當使用數(shù)據(jù)結(jié)構(gòu)來實現(xiàn)緩存時,LRU(LeastRecentlyUsed)策略是一種常見的淘汰算法。假設(shè)一個緩存容量有限,需要不斷替換元素。以下關(guān)于LRU策略的實現(xiàn),哪個數(shù)據(jù)結(jié)構(gòu)可能是最適合的()A.棧B.隊列C.哈希表D.雙向鏈表5、設(shè)計一個基于運算放大器的電壓比較器電路,能夠比較兩個輸入電壓的大小,并輸出相應(yīng)的高低電平信號。6、利用數(shù)字邏輯電路設(shè)計一個數(shù)字電壓表,能夠測量直流電壓并以數(shù)字形式顯示,給出測量精度和量程。7、對于一個需要快速計算一個字符串的所有子串的問題,以下哪種數(shù)據(jù)結(jié)構(gòu)和算法的組合可能是最有效的?()A.后綴數(shù)組和相關(guān)算法B.前綴樹和遍歷C.鏈表和字符串操作D.數(shù)組和循環(huán)8、設(shè)計一個基于數(shù)字溫度傳感器的溫度控制系統(tǒng),通過控制加熱或制冷設(shè)備,使環(huán)境溫度保持在設(shè)定范圍內(nèi)。9、設(shè)計一個智能安防監(jiān)控系統(tǒng),能夠?qū)崿F(xiàn)視頻監(jiān)控、入侵檢測和報警功能,給出系統(tǒng)的硬件架構(gòu)和軟件實現(xiàn)方案。10、利用集成電路設(shè)計方法,設(shè)計一款用于音頻播放設(shè)備的音頻功率放大器芯片,具備高效率和低失真的特性。11、樹是一種非線性數(shù)據(jù)結(jié)構(gòu),具有層次關(guān)系。以下關(guān)于樹的描述,不正確的是:()A.二叉樹的每個節(jié)點最多有兩個子節(jié)點,分為左子節(jié)點和右子節(jié)點B.二叉搜索樹的左子樹中的節(jié)點值小于根節(jié)點值,右子樹中的節(jié)點值大于根節(jié)點值,便于快速查找、插入和刪除C.平衡二叉樹通過自動調(diào)整保持樹的平衡,提高了查找效率,但插入和刪除操作相對復(fù)雜D.樹的遍歷方式包括前序遍歷、中序遍歷和后序遍歷,且每種遍歷方式的時間復(fù)雜度都是相同的,與樹的結(jié)構(gòu)無關(guān)12、設(shè)計一個基于51單片機的智能安防系統(tǒng),能夠檢測門窗的開關(guān)狀態(tài)、人體紅外信號,并通過GSM模塊發(fā)送報警短信。13、設(shè)計一個基于單片機的溫度控制系統(tǒng),能夠?qū)崟r監(jiān)測環(huán)境溫度,并通過控制加熱或制冷設(shè)備將溫度穩(wěn)定在設(shè)定范圍內(nèi),給出硬件電路和軟件程序設(shè)計。14、設(shè)計一個基于單片機的智能車庫照明系統(tǒng),根據(jù)車輛進出自動控制燈光的開啟和關(guān)閉。15、根據(jù)傳感器原理,設(shè)計一個用于智能家居的人體紅外感應(yīng)系統(tǒng),能夠?qū)崿F(xiàn)自動開燈、關(guān)空調(diào)等智能控制。16、在樹的存儲結(jié)構(gòu)中,除了二叉樹,還有多叉樹。假設(shè)一個多叉樹的每個節(jié)點的孩子節(jié)點數(shù)量不確定,以下哪種存儲方式可能更靈活()A.雙親表示法B.孩子表示法C.孩子兄弟表示法D.以上方式都不靈活17、利用電力電子技術(shù)設(shè)計一個不間斷電源(UPS)系統(tǒng),在市電中斷時能夠為負載提供持續(xù)的電力供應(yīng)。18、根據(jù)模擬電路理論,設(shè)計一個用于醫(yī)療設(shè)備的生物電信號放大器,能夠放大微弱的生物電信號,如心電、腦電等。19、設(shè)計一個基于藍牙5.0技術(shù)的智能家居設(shè)備組網(wǎng)系統(tǒng),實現(xiàn)設(shè)備之間的互聯(lián)互通和協(xié)同工作。20、在鏈表這種數(shù)據(jù)結(jié)構(gòu)中,每個節(jié)點包含數(shù)據(jù)和指向下一個節(jié)點的指針。假設(shè)存在一個單向鏈表,包含元素10、20、30、40、50,其中頭節(jié)點存儲的值為10。如果要刪除值為30的節(jié)點,需要對鏈表進行相應(yīng)的操作。以下哪種操作步驟是正確的?()A.從頭節(jié)點開始遍歷,找到值為30的節(jié)點,將其直接刪除B.從頭節(jié)點開始遍歷,找到值為30的節(jié)點,將其前一個節(jié)點的指針指向其后一個節(jié)點C.從尾節(jié)點開始遍歷,找到值為30的節(jié)點,將其刪除D.無需遍歷,直接刪除值為30的節(jié)點21、鏈表也是一種常見的線性表結(jié)構(gòu)。假設(shè)我們正在使用一個單向鏈表。以下關(guān)于鏈表的描述,哪一項是不正確的?()A.鏈表在插入和刪除元素時,只需修改相關(guān)節(jié)點的指針,操作較為靈活B.單向鏈表只能從表頭向表尾方向遍歷,無法反向遍歷C.鏈表的存儲空間不需要連續(xù),可以充分利用零散的內(nèi)存空間D.鏈表的查找操作需要從頭節(jié)點依次遍歷,效率相對較低22、運用通信網(wǎng)絡(luò)原理,設(shè)計一個智能物流倉儲管理系統(tǒng)的無線網(wǎng)絡(luò)方案,實現(xiàn)貨物的實時定位和信息傳輸。23、設(shè)計一個射頻電路中的功率放大器,工作在特定頻段,具有較高的輸出功率和效率,進行穩(wěn)定性分析。24、利用數(shù)字電路技術(shù),設(shè)計一個智能電梯群控系統(tǒng),優(yōu)化多部電梯的運行調(diào)度,提高運輸效率。25、設(shè)計一個基于UWB技術(shù)的室內(nèi)定位系統(tǒng),定位精度達到厘米級,說明系統(tǒng)組成和定位算法。二、簡答題(本大題共4個小題,共20分)1、(本題5分)論述如何在一個有向圖中計算強連通分量,給出具體的算法步驟。2、(本題5分)解釋二叉搜索樹的概念和特點,分析其查找、插入和刪除操作的時間復(fù)雜度,并討論如何保持其平衡性。3、(本題5分)描述二叉樹的遍歷算法在二叉樹的路徑總和問題、節(jié)點間最大距離問題中的應(yīng)用。4、(本題5分)論述在一個具有n個頂點的無向圖中,如何使用廣度優(yōu)先搜索算法來生成連通分量。三、設(shè)計題(本大題共5個小題,共25分)1、(本題5分)設(shè)計一個程序,使用快速排序算法對一個有向圖的強連通分量進行排序。2、(本題5分)設(shè)計一個程序,實現(xiàn)對二叉搜索樹的平衡調(diào)整,當輸入的二叉搜索樹不平衡時進行調(diào)整并展示結(jié)果。3、(本題5分)設(shè)計一個算法,利用二叉搜索樹存儲員工的考勤記錄,能夠快速查找特定時間段的考勤情況。4、(本題5分)使用雙向鏈表和平衡二叉樹的結(jié)合,設(shè)計一個程序,實現(xiàn)對學生綜合成績的管理,包括成績的錄入、查詢和排名。5、(本題5分)設(shè)計一個算法,在給定的帶權(quán)有向圖中計算兩個頂點之間的次短路徑,輸出路徑和長度。四、綜合題(本大題共3個小題,共30分)1、(本題10分)某電商平臺的促銷活動規(guī)則管理系統(tǒng)需要定義不同的促銷活動類型、適用商品、優(yōu)惠條件、活動時間等。設(shè)計數(shù)據(jù)結(jié)構(gòu)來存儲和管理促銷活動規(guī)則,支持活動的創(chuàng)建、修改、刪除和查詢,能夠準確計算商品在活動中的優(yōu)惠價格。2、(本題10分)假設(shè)一個視頻網(wǎng)站需要存儲大量的視頻信息和用戶的觀看記錄,視頻信息包括視頻ID、視頻名稱、時長、上傳者、分類等,觀看記錄包括用戶ID、視頻I

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
  • 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論